Pant scored historical century
Pant scored 118 runs against England. Pant scored at a strike rate of around 85. He played a total of 140 balls. In this innings, Pant hit 15 fours and three sixes. Pant created history by scoring this century. Pant also scored a century in the first innings of this match. Pant scored 134 runs in the first innings. Pant became the first Indian wicketkeeper batsman to score two centuries in a Test during this period.
This test of Pant is the 8th century of career. Pant became the player to score the most centuries for India as a wicketkeeper in this Test. Pant broke MS Dhoni’s record during this period. Dhoni has scored 6 centuries in Test cricket. At the same time, there have been 8 centuries in Pant’s Test.
